|  | Registered User Owner, Iron Ether Electronics | | Join Date: Dec 2002 Location: LA US | | | I haven't used one, but based on the type of pitch shifting it does, it should work just as well on chords as single notes. It doesn't do any pitch tracking so it doesn't care what you play into it. Now the PS-5 in harmonist mode definitely will not work with chords. |

| | Registered User | | Join Date: Jun 2007 Location: Adelaide, Australia | | the chimes, bells, whistles etc are controllable,...
its really more about how far away you are shifting the pitch and where you are playing on the fretboard,...
playing above the twelfth fret on the G string with octave up for example will get you all sorts of lovely bells whistles and chimes, havent tried it but im assuming would get demented sounds on the B string trying to go one-two octave up or one-two octave down
the tardis type sounds ive generally gotten with an expression pedal rocking from one octave up to two octaves up... it just generally excels at crazy sounds thats why ive used it as such...
